Maurice Hill, 36, is accused of shooting six Philadelphia police officers last year. PHILADELPHIA - A Philadelphia man who is accused of shooting six police officers during an hours-long standoff last year is due in court for a preliminary hearing Thursday.The hearing comes just a one day shy of the one year anniversary of the incident.Maurice Hill, then 36, is facing a long list of charges in the non-fatal shootings of six officers, along with attempted murder and related charges for 62 other officers who were in the line of fire that day.Authorities say Hill first opened fire on officers as they served a drug warrant at a Tioga rowhome back on Aug.
